“…The second-harmonic signal is injected through the embedded broadband bandpass filter at the gate of the packaged transistor to further enhance the efficiency via the tuning of the intrinsic output loadlines of the transistor. The effectiveness of the CW and modulated active second-harmonic injection methodology presented in this paper are validated by the improvements in the efficiency experimentally reported in [3]. At 2 GHz, it can be observed that the drain efficiency improves by 15% for CW signals and 9.7% for a frequency-modulated 30 MHz chirp signal.…”
